Stepping Over the Excitement: Why Some Electronic Cigarettes Emit Thick Aerosol
Despite the advertising portraying vapes as sleek devices that only create wispy, cloud-like vapor, a significant quantity of consumers have observed a more hazy vapor output . This isn't always a malfunction ; several elements can contribute this phenomenon. Device design , e-liquid consistency, and even draw settings can all affect the look of the aerosol. Certain ingredients within the liquid, like vegetable glycerin , tend to create a heavier vapor compared to others. Ultimately, understanding these intricacies can help enthusiasts troubleshoot unexpected vapor properties and improve their usage .
